About Overjet

Overjet.ai focuses on enhancing oral health through artificial intelligence solutions tailored for the dental industry. The company offers two main products: the Clinical Intelligence Platform and the Claim Intelligence Platform. The Clinical Intelligence Platform assists dental providers by integrating AI insights from dental radiographs with patient and treatment data, which helps improve clinical performance and patient outcomes. Meanwhile, the Claim Intelligence Platform aids insurance companies by analyzing radiographic claims to streamline the claims review process, allowing for quicker approvals and enabling examiners to concentrate on more complex claims. Overjet.ai distinguishes itself from competitors by specifically targeting the dental sector and providing tailored solutions that enhance both clinical care and administrative efficiency. The company's goal is to create a future where dental care is more precise, efficient, and centered around patient needs.

Differentiation

Overjet is the first FDA-cleared AI technology for dental pathologies.
Overjet's AI platforms cater to both dental providers and insurance payers.
Overjet for Kids is the only FDA-cleared AI for pediatric tooth decay detection.
